For the parallel resonant circuit given below, the value of the inductive and capacitive reactance is _________(a) XL = 654.289 Ω; XC = 458.216 Ω(b) XL = 985.457 Ω; XC = 875.245 Ω(c) XL = 785.394 Ω; XC = 785.417 Ω(d) XL = 125.354 Ω; XC = 657.215 ΩThe question was posed to me in examination.The above asked question is from Problems of Parallel Resonance Involving Quality Factor topic in section Resonance & Magnetically Coupled Circuit of Network Theory

Answer»

Correct choice is (c) XL = 785.394 Ω; XC = 785.417 Ω

To EXPLAIN: Resonant Frequency, F = \(\frac{1}{2π\sqrt{LC}} \)

= \(\frac{1}{6.28\sqrt{(100×10^{-6})(162.11×10^{-12})}}\)

= \(\frac{1}{6.28\sqrt{1.621×10^{-14}}}\)

= \(\frac{1}{799×10^{-9}}\) = 1.25 MHz.

Inductive REACTANCE, XL = 2πfL = (6.28) (1.25×10^6)(100×10^-6)

= 785.394 Ω

Capacitive Reactance, XC = \(\frac{1}{2πfC} = \frac{1}{(6.28)(1.25×10^6)(162.11×10^{-12})}\)

= \(\frac{1}{1.273×10^{-3}}\) = 785.417 Ω.
